Using Summer Like for High-Impact Social Media Graphics
When integrating Summer Like into our social media strategy, the primary goal was to stop the scroll. In the crowded landscape of digital advertising, Fonts play a crucial role in establishing immediate brand recognition. This Script Handwritten style excels in short, punchy headlines where emotional connection is key. For our Instagram carousel posts, I used Summer Like for the cover slide titles, such as "Glow From Within" and "Summer Essentials." The flowing nature of the letters created a sense of movement that guided the viewer’s eye across the graphic. However, readability on small screens is always a concern with script typefaces. I found that keeping the text size large and ensuring high contrast against light, airy backgrounds worked best. The distinct loops and tails of the characters remained clear even in thumbnail previews, which is vital for maintaining message clarity in fast-moving feeds. For Reels covers, the font’s timeless style added a layer of sophistication that static images often lack, making the content feel more curated and premium.

It is important to note that while Summer Like is incredibly distinct, it works best as a display font. Using it for body copy or dense information would hinder readability, so I paired it with a clean, geometric sans serif for the finer details. This combination ensured that the campaign maintained its visual hierarchy, with the script font drawing attention and the sans serif providing necessary context.

Strategic Font Pairing and Readability Best Practices
To maximize the impact of Summer Like, understanding how to pair it with other Fonts is essential. This Script Handwritten typeface shines when contrasted with structured, modern typography. In our email newsletter headers, I paired Summer Like with a lightweight sans serif for the subheadings and body text. This pairing created a balanced composition where the script font acted as the emotional anchor, and the sans serif provided logical structure. For web design elements, such as landing page heroes, the same principle applied. The elegant touch of Summer Like drew users into the narrative, while the supporting text guided them toward conversion. Readability advice for this font includes avoiding all-caps usage, as script fonts are designed to mimic natural handwriting flow, which is disrupted by uniform capitalization. Additionally, generous letter spacing in the paired font helps prevent visual clutter. When using Summer Like for logo design or brand labels, ensure there is ample whitespace around the text to let the distinctive ligatures breathe. This approach enhances brand recognition and ensures that the font’s personality is communicated clearly.
